TomTom Multi-Sport GPS watch

Many novice and experienced runners use GPS watches. They're great for keeping a close eye on your average pace throughout a run, particularly during those last few kilometres when you're striving towards the finish line.

The TomTom Multi-Sport is reliable, durable GPS watch suited for runners, swimmers and cyclists of all levels. We feel it's on par with other entry-level models for a similar price.

Single button for easy menu navigation; Watch face & button slip out of band as one unit; Price comparable to other entry-level GPS watches;

Battery life could be improved; Heart rate monitor is an extra cost;

TomTom Runner GPS Watch Review

TomTom is taking its knowledge of automotive GPS to the fitness world with the $169 Runner GPS watch. This light and comfortable wristwatch can track your runs - both outdoors and on a treadmill - and then uploads the data to one of several fitness sites.

Comfortable to wear; Easy to read while you run; Intuitive controls; Good battery life

Can't sync workout data via Bluetooth; Doesn't record split times
